--Random brain-leak blurps below--

* Graphics are really nice, they are using a modified Crytek engine to run the game. Zones are beautiful & diverse. Characters are modeled VERY well, and have a nice/smooth feel to their movements. i've tried playing alot of the other mmos out there either the character animations bugged me (guild wars) , or the world environment was blah (lotro), or the graphics were just to unimpressive (most all Free2Play MMOs with the exception of Swords of the new world)
* Soundtrack is INCREDIBLE, i paid for the collector edition pre-order, that comes with a CD with the original soundtrack to the game.
* Chain Skills! After completeing a stdard attack, a secondard attack opens up. for example in warcraft if you mage cast fireball, then fireblast would become available. or if you cast frostbolt, then a frost nova with knockback would become available.
To cut down on clutter for the action bars, if you have fireball in slot-2..... after you cast fireball, slot 2 would change into fireblast. so you could just spam 2,2,2,2,2,2 and it would auto complete the chain/combo for you. It will also place a clickable
button for the next available chain in the same general area as some of the ArcHUD/IceHUD warcraft addons place their status bars.
* You gain your wings/flight at a very early level, flying is a very integral part of the game.
* I've played the first 12 or so levels and they go by really quick, without grinding so far. I'm actually worried some of my quests will go grey before i finish them. The quests genres are the usual. Collection, delivery, kill. On collection quests, drop rates are fairly high. I havent complained yet about when a item is going to drop.
* All trainer skills are taught by books, kinda like the warlock pet grimores back in the day.. you can by them ahead of time so that when you level they will be in your inventory and you can right click them when you are of appropriate level to use them.
no more hearthing/flying back to the trainer every level.
* Quest log/tracking system is nice. it will track as many quests that will fit on the right side of the screen. each one tracked has a clickable button for "remove from tracking", or "open quest log entry for this quest" Anytime you pick up a quest item, it will do a small on screen notice of what you picked up, what quest it was for, and how many more you need.
* When you complete a quest it will mark the turn in point on your map so you dont have to go looking it up again. All NPC names, and Zone locations in the quest log/descrption are clickable and will bring up a small history box about them, and if that doesnt help, the history box has a "locate" button you can press to mark a waypoint marker on your map for it.
* Has both the standard map screen, or a diablo][ type transparent overlay map.
* When you move to a new zone, or subzone you can click on a obliesk item to set your "Bind Point", when is where you will hearthstone to, or resurect to when you die. this does cost gold (100g to 300g) but just to give you an idea, by the time i sold all my grey vendor trash at level 9, i have about 9k gold.
* there are flight masters & flight points. also teleporters to main cities are usually bundled with them too.
* vendors have a 1 click "Sell grey item" type button
* you get 1 backpack, but you can pay to have it "expanded" to a larger size
* character classes Scout which later specializes either ranger (hunter) or assassin(rogue, stealth), they have a warrior-type(fury/arms), or templar(paladin-prot), priest type, mage type, sorcerer (sorta like a warlock, because of elemental pet summoning)

Sam D.W. - they have a pretty crazy macro system. you can have more than 1 spell/action per macro and there is a delay macro to put inbetween the casts. Its allowed, unlike in wow. I havent found the /Follow equvielant, but i also cant find a good codex of all the different macro/script commands. The "Attack" button (when targeting a enemy) will run you to the mob and start attacking, BUT when targeting a NPC, the "Attack" button doubles as the newer WoW "Interact with Target" button, and will walk to the NPC and open the dialog box to it. Targeting a Friendly Player, and using the "Attack" button will move you to that friendly player, so you could use that as a follow keybind i guess.

Lyonheart - it is running "game guard" anti hacking/cheating software. its a widely used "warden" like program, but apparently it is easily defeated in some of the googling around of "what is gameguard?" i dont know if they are going to use it for the USA/EU release, but most likely. Just having Innerspace loaded in, but not running. It gets past the game guard check, but the game client locks up. I try it will keyclone, but i cannot get keys to pass "to" or "from" the game client. Looks like this is a hardware boxing game, seems like the game-guard is blocking/protecting the keyboard functions? probably a way around it but it might cause troubles with EULA, terms&conditions, etc.....

So an update on boxing this game. Attempting to play with some options I couldn't read this morning I successfully broke the launcher for the game. :) Lucky for me I made a backup. It will not let you load another launcher after the game is already launched...it gives you a big fat error. So, in the PlayNCLauncher.ini file you can set 'AutoClose=0' and the launcher stays open letting you load as many instances as your computer can handle. I can throw 5 WoWs at my machine and I don't have a problem....while loading the 3rd and 4th instances of Aion...things were getting real slow while loading. Everything seemed fine though on the window I was focused on. Here's a quick screenshot ('http://malice.ws/bin/images/aion/multiple_aion.png') of what I came up with this morning. The window size you see in that screenshot is the size that Aion forces your windows in 'Windowed' mode, at least on my computer. Don't let that screenshot fool you...InnerSpace is running but I'm not using it for running multiple copies of the game. I'm not sure how you'd use InnerSpace with using the Launcher.
